- The distance between Potsdam, Germany and Boende, Democratic Republic Of The Congo is approximately 5,894 km or 3,663 mi.
- To reach Potsdam in this distance one would set out from Boende bearing 354.1° or N and follow the great circles arc to approach Potsdam bearing 350.2° or N .
- Potsdam has a marine west coast climate (Cfb) whereas Boende has a tropical rainforest climate (Af).
- Potsdam is in or near the cool temperate moist forest biome whereas Boende is in or near the tropical moist forest biome.
- The mean temperature is 16.8 °C (30.3°F) cooler.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 17.3 °C (31.1°F) more in Potsdam. The continentality subtype is semicontinental as opposed to extremely hyperoceanic.
- Total annual precipitation averages 1524 mm (60 in) less which is equivalent to 1524 l/m² (37.4 US gal/ft²) or 15,240,000 l/ha (1,629,257 US gal/ac) less. About 2/7 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 37° lower in Potsdam than in Boende.
